安全地处理网络请求与响应:构建安全处理中心的实践指南
一、引言
随着信息技术的飞速发展,网络请求与响应的处理已成为现代应用不可或缺的一部分。
随着网络攻击的不断升级,如何安全地处理网络请求与响应成为了一个亟待解决的问题。
本文将介绍安全处理中心的构建方法,以提高网络请求与响应的安全性,保障用户数据的安全。
二、网络请求与响应概述
网络请求是指客户端向服务器发送的数据,请求服务器提供某种服务或资源。
网络响应则是服务器对客户端请求的回应,包括请求的结果、错误信息等。
在处理网络请求与响应的过程中,我们需要关注以下几个关键点:
1. 请求的发起方和接收方:确保请求来自合法的客户端,防止恶意攻击。
2. 请求的内容:对请求的数据进行验证和过滤,防止恶意代码注入。
3. 响应的内容:确保响应的数据不会被篡改,防止信息泄露。
三、安全处理中心构建
为了安全地处理网络请求与响应,我们需要构建一个安全处理中心。安全处理中心的构建主要包括以下几个方面:
1. 防火墙与入侵检测系统(IDS)
防火墙是网络安全的第一道防线,能够过滤掉不安全的请求。
IDS则能够实时监控网络流量,发现异常行为并及时报警。
通过合理配置防火墙和IDS,可以有效阻止恶意攻击。
2. 网络安全审计
网络安全审计是对网络请求与响应的监控和分析过程,以发现潜在的安全风险。
通过审计,我们可以了解网络请求的来源、频率、内容等信息,分析异常行为,并及时采取应对措施。
3. 请求验证与过滤
对于每一个网络请求,我们需要进行验证和过滤。
验证请求的来源、数据格式和内容,确保请求来自合法的客户端且数据完整。
过滤掉可能包含恶意代码的请求,防止恶意攻击。
4. 加密传输
为了保证数据在传输过程中的安全,我们需要对请求和响应进行加密处理。
使用HTTPS等加密协议,确保数据在传输过程中不会被窃取或篡改。
5. 响应验证与处理
对于服务器返回的响应,我们需要进行验证和处理。
验证响应的数据格式和内容,确保数据的完整性。
处理异常响应,及时通知用户并采取相应的措施。
四、安全处理中心的运行流程
安全处理中心的运行流程主要包括以下几个步骤:
1. 接收网络请求:通过防火墙和IDS对请求进行初步筛选和监控。
2. 请求验证与过滤:对请求进行验证和过滤,确保请求的安全。
3. 处理请求:将安全的请求发送给相应的服务进行处理。
4. 接收网络响应:接收服务器返回的响应。
5. 响应验证与处理:对响应进行验证和处理,确保响应的安全。
6. 返回响应给用户:将安全的响应返回给用户。
7. 监控与分析:对处理过程进行监控和分析,发现异常行为及时报警。
五、总结与展望
安全地处理网络请求与响应是保障网络安全的重要一环。
通过构建安全处理中心,我们可以有效提高网络请求与响应的安全性,保障用户数据的安全。
未来,随着技术的不断发展,我们需要关注新兴的安全威胁和技术,不断完善安全处理中心的功能和策略,提高网络安全防护能力。
评论一下吧
取消回复